Cynomorium is used for impotence in men and lack of libido in women due to deficiency of Kidney Yang energy.

Function and Indication: Nourish kidney yang, replenish vital essence and blood, moisten the bowels to relieve constipation. Indicated for lassitude in loin and knee, impotence and seminal emission, dry intestine and constipation.
Invigorate the kidney and supplement essence.
Moisturize the intestine and relax the bowels.
Action: to reinforce the kidney yang, to replenish vital essence and blood, and to relax bowels.

Safety and Toxicity:
Generally safe when properly suggested,Blurred vision is a potential side effect from high dose Cynomorium songaricum;Cynomorium is not well suited to people who are severely Yin deficient since it is primarily a Yang herb. Also, it is not well suited to people who are suffering either chronically or acutely from diarrhea since it tends to loosen stool.
